<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-creamy-spring-risotto-with-green-asparagus-and-vermouth-whats-important">Creamy spring risotto recipe with green asparagus and vermouth – What&#8217;s important!</h2>



<p>This is a classic risotto recipe that has a very creamy risotto texture. The vermouth, lemon zest, and the asparagus give this classic Italian rice dish a beautiful twist, which makes it a perfect spring dish for your dinner table and one of these fabulous risotto recipe ideas.<img src="https://s.w.org/images/core/emoji/17.0.2/72x72/1f60a.png" alt="😊" class="wp-smiley" style="height: 1em; max-height: 1em;" /></p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>First step: I always&nbsp;<strong>prepare all my ingredients</strong>&nbsp;in advance. There is nothing more annoying than having to search for the ingredients like a frantic little hen during the cooking and eventually burning the rice. Nobody wants that.</li>



<li>I roast the risotto rice with the minced shallots in olive oil over medium heat for a couple of minutes until the grains are golden brown. This releases some of its flavors and starts fuming heavenly.</li>



<li>Stir the rice constantly with a <strong>wooden spoon</strong>.</li>



<li>When the risotto rice starts to smell, I add the vermouth.</li>



<li>I&#8217;m using vermouth and dry white wine. It adds a richer flavor to the risotto and the asparagus.</li>



<li>Don’t be afraid of the added alcohol for the declacing. The<strong> alcohol vaporizes</strong> in the process and only leaves that fantastic flavor. Promised.&nbsp;</li>



<li><strong>I don’t add all of the hot stock at once</strong>. I add some of the soup and let it soak in the risotto, then add some more cups of broth and let it soak again, and so on.</li>



<li>Let the rice cook on a low simmer.</li>



<li>Of course you can use your own homemade stock. Use chicken broth or vegetable broth whatever you prefer.</li>



<li>Yes you definitely need<strong>&nbsp;all that butter, cream and parmesan cheese</strong>. Be my guest to add more cheese if you feel like it.</li>



<li><strong>The vegetable stock is an about thing.</strong>&nbsp;Maybe your risotto rice brand will need more or less soup then I wrote in my recipe. When the rice is AL DENTE, the Risotto is ready for the finishing.</li>
</ul>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="what-ist-the-perfect-risotto-rice">What is the perfect risotto rice.</h2>



<p>To find the perfect risotto rice, it is useful to study the consistency and cooking behavior of the different types of rice. Basically, in Italy, you cook the creamiest risotto with Arborio rice, Carnaroli rice and Vialone nano rice. All three are a starchy variety of rice and have a high starch content.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="what-to-do-with-leftover-risotto-rice">What to do with leftover-risotto rice.</h2>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>My favorite recipe including leftover-risotto is Arancini . Arancinis are rice balls made of leftover-risotto rice stuffed with cheese , covered in bread crumbs and fried to golden perfection. This is so tasty and delicious .</li>
</ul>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="how-to-store-risotto">How to store risotto.</h2>



<p>While risotto is at its best when it&#8217;s fresh, if you do happen to have leftover, it will be fine in the refrigerator. The risotto will thicken because of the rice’s starch. Just store the risotto in an airtight container up to 5 days in your refrigerator. If your risotto happens to contain meat, store it up to 3 days in your refrigerator.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="how-to-reheat-risotto">How to reheat risotto.</h2>



<p>For every cup of risotto add 1/4 cup of hot broth and bring everything to a boil on the stove in a pot large enough to fit the risotto. Stir it for a few minutes until the rice warms up. If the risotto is still quite thick, you can add a splash or two more broth, as needed, to loosen it up.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ading"> What is a quiche?</h2>



<p>A quiche is a <strong>savory French tart </strong>consisting of a <strong>flaky pie</strong> crust or pastry crust and filled with a <strong>savory creamy custard</strong> (heavy cream, milk and seasoning) and filling ingredients.</p>



<p>It&#8217;s a <strong>delicious classic recipe</strong> with a flaky crust that is so versatile in hindsight to the quiche fillings as you can add pretty much anything you can think of to the basic ingredients. From simple muchrooms and peppers to more creative ingredients like chopped spinach and caramelized onions, there’s so much you can do with quiche.</p>



<p>Quiches are <strong>typically served at brunch or breakfast</strong>. There are so many different variations of quiche and new flavor combinations are being created every day! <strong>Make sure to give my Italian asparagus quiche recipe a try.</strong></p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="683" height="1024" data-pin-url="https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/italian-asparagus-quiche/?tp_image_id=6740"  data-pin-title="Easy  Delicious Italian Asparagus Quiche Recipe"  data-pin-description="This is an Easy Delicious Italian Asparagus quiche Recipe. It's a delicious green asparagus recipe and a perfect breakfast recipe,  brunch recipe or lunch recipe. #asparagusquiche #asparagusrecipes #greenasparagus #lunchrecipe #brunchrecipe #bestquicherecipe "   src="https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-683x1024.jpg" alt="easy Italian asparagus quiche recipe, asparagus quiche , asparagus recipe, lunch recipe, brunch recipe, breakfast recipe, delicious quiche " class="wp-image-6740" srcset="https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-683x1024.jpg 683w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-200x300.jpg 200w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-768x1152.jpg 768w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-1024x1536.jpg 1024w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-960x1440.jpg 960w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-267x400.jpg 267w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245-585x877.jpg 585w, https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/05/IMG_1245.jpg 1067w" sizes="(max-width: 683px) 100vw, 683px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ading has-normal-font-size"> The origin of quiche.</h2>



<p>When people think of the French word quiche they assume that the traditional quiche origins from the Lorraine region of France.</p>



<p>But food historians know that&nbsp;historical records indicate that&nbsp;<strong>quiche actually originated in Germany in the middle ages in the medieval kingdom of Lothringen</strong>, which the French later occupied and renamed Lorraine. The word &#8216;quiche&#8217; is from the German word &#8216;Kuchen&#8217;, meaning cake.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Can I make a crustless quiche too?</h2>



<p>Sure you can, a crustless quiches resembles more a fritatta or an egg omelet since the pie crust is missing. Though the taste of a quiche is more richer and less eggy but its a <strong>great gluten-free alternative</strong>.</p>



<p>Just omit the crust and spray a pie from with cooking spray and add the egg mixture and the filling and bake at 175°C (350°F) for 35 minutes or until the center is set.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">How to make this easy delicious Italian asparagus Quiche recipe.</h2>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>We start with making the quiche crust!</strong></h3>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>&nbsp;Pulse</strong> flour, salt and butter in a food processor until everything resembles coarse meal with only a few bigger pieces of butter.</li>



<li>Add milk and pulse until dough holds slightly together.</li>



<li>On a floured surface, roll the dough with the help of a rolling pin into a thin circle.</li>



<li>Transfer the dough to a tart pan or pie pan.</li>



<li>Allow dough to hang slightly over the pan, about 3 cm.</li>



<li>Fold the excess dough under. Pinch and crimp. Chill for 30 minutes.</li>
</ul>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Now in the meantime we make the filling!</strong></h2>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Over medium heat with 2 tbsp of olive oil bake the prosciutto until crispy. Let it dry on some paper towels. Then crush it into smaller pieces.</li>



<li>Over medium heat, soften the onions with 2 tbsp of olive oil. Add the asparagus, mushrooms and sauté . Add the vegetable broth and reduce until nearly evaporated. Remove from heat and let it cool slightly. Season with salt and pepper to your liking.</li>



<li>Combine the eggs with the milk. Add all of the cheese but safe 20g. Spread the saved grated cheese directly onto the dough.</li>



<li>Then add half of the prosciutto chips.&nbsp;</li>



<li>Then layer the asparagus, mushroom mixture on top except the tips (you will need them in the later).&nbsp;</li>



<li>Pour the savory custard filling into the prepared pie shell.</li>



<li>And finally arrange the asparagus tips and the remaining prosciutto chips on top.</li>



<li>Bake for 50 minutes or until the egg filling is set.</li>



<li>Cool for a 10 minutes to let it set before cutting.</li>



<li>Can be eaten cold, warm or right out of the oven.</li>
</ul>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Can you make a quiche ahead of time or freeze it?</h2>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Of course you can. This easy Italian asparagus quiche is ideal to make it ahead of time and keep it for up to 3 days in your fridge or freeze it up to 3 months .</li>



<li>Just let it cool on your kitchen counter for up to 2 hours.</li>



<li>If refrigerating simply wrap top with foil.</li>



<li>If freezing first wrap in foil and than put it in an airtight container.</li>



<li>Thaw frozen quiche for one day when ready to serve.</li>



<li>To reheat: first cover the top in foil and than bake at 160°C (325°F) until it heated through.</li>
</ul>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Variations:</h2>



<p>There are so many ways to make a quiche. Maybe you want to try our &#8220;<a href="https://www.twosisterslivinglife.com/roasted-pumpkin-leek-quiche/">Best Easy Roasted Pumpkin Leek Quiche Recipe Ever&#8221;</a>?  Or try one of these variations.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Spinach Quiche</strong> : fresh spinach, nutmeg, gruyere cheese (If you dint get your hands on fresh spinach use frozen spinach.</li>



<li><strong>Quiche Lorraine</strong> : cook 100g Bacon until crisp, drain the crisp bacon then chop. Add a pinch of nutmeg and optionally tender cooked leek.</li>



<li><strong>Mushroom quiche</strong>: Saute 100g sliced Mushrooms and 50g green onions in butter until tender and the mushrooms are shrunken and golden brown. Optionally add a twig of fresh rosemary while cooking.</li>
</ul>
